Anthony Banks, known simply as Ant Banks, is a producer and rapper from Oakland, California. As a child he took band in school and from there learned to play a variety of instruments along the way. At school he only learned Classical, but at home he taught himself to play Funk related music like Parliament, Funkadelic and The Gap Band on his Casio keyboard. Interested in making music, he would create beats and record his own versions for fun.
